Bad News: Record Oil Imports into China in 2023

CleanTechnica EVs

China is well known as the world’s leading electric vehicle (EV) market. More than half of the world’s EV sales have occurred there in recent years. In 2023, 25% of auto sales in China were sales of full electric vehicles. It is a standard of the rapid, uplifting EV revolution.

Stellantis-Leapmotor eSUV details revealed in sales license for China

Teslarati

Stellantis-Leapmotor C16 SUV details were leaked after the companies filed for a sales license with China’s Ministry of Industry and Information Technology (MIIT). Stellantis and Leapmotor’s new SUV will have six seats and likely compete with the Aito M7. Last year, Stellantis started to strengthen its ties in China.

Renault CEO calls for Auto European plan to protect against ‘onslaught of EVs from China’

Teslarati

Renault CEO Luca de Meo released a 19-page open letter to Europe describing an auto European plan to protect against the ‘onslaught of electric vehicles (EV)’ coming from China.” He pointed out that electric vehicles and plug-in hybrids account for 14% of global car sales, led by Asian automakers.
